Transaction d4e85eaf2344fdf29c79a004b47cd75b3069cf869fac990164bc6787f1bae93b

1 Input
2 Outputs
  • d4e85eaf2344fdf29c79a004b47cd75b3069cf869fac990164bc6787f1bae93b:0
  • value  15803353
    address  39iHupFf26grr9cdxSRwT6ZVKH8cRSnmgT
  • d4e85eaf2344fdf29c79a004b47cd75b3069cf869fac990164bc6787f1bae93b:1
  • value  33803375
    address  38jvwyfAX9WbSAnLpfXSrP6HpvcSPHhAYH